Replace 2GIS MapKit with OpenStreetMap (osmdroid) — no key needed
Getting a working mobile-SDK key from 2GIS turned out to require a sales-mediated B2B process (Platform Manager subscription, demo keys explicitly excluded from mobile SDK use per their own docs), not a quick self-serve signup. Swapped to osmdroid instead: free, no API key or account, works immediately. CityMapView (replacing DgisMapView/DgisSdkProvider) wraps osmdroid's View-based MapView via AndroidView, forwarding lifecycle events, with markers for the user's location and each nearby place. Configured required OSM tile-usage-policy user agent + app-private tile cache in GuideCityApp. Removed the now-unused DGIS_API_KEY plumbing and the arm64-only ABI filter (osmdroid has no heavy native libs, so it's not needed) — APK is back down to ~19.6MB from ~69MB. Verified: testDebugUnitTest passes, assembleDebug produces a working APK, sent via the Telegram bot (previously blocked by its 50MB limit with the 2GIS build).
